AWSCPA Mission
The
American Woman's Society of Certified Public Accountants (AWSCPA) is
a national organization dedicated to serving all women CPAs. The
AWSCPA provides a supportive environment and valuable resources for
members to achieve their personal and professional goals through
various opportunities including advocacy, networking, leadership
training, education, and public awareness.

Implementing Healthcare
Reform
1 hour of CPE for only $10 for members and $15
for nonmembers. What a deal.
Thursday, September 23, 2010
11:00 AM Arizona Time
Beach Fleischman
1985 E River Road, Ste 200
Louis Pasquesi is the Vice President of Viti Financial,
Chicagoland's premier provider of healthcare benefits and financial
services for businesses, families and individuals for 70 years. In
his role, Louis applies his 20 years of experience in the
healthcare industry to providing 300 clients with customized
benefits packages to best suit their needs.
Louis will be discussing the initial phase of health care reform
provisions and what it means to you and your employer.
Topics will include:
· Grandfathered Plans
· Employer Responsibilities
· What's on the Radar Screen

Our upcoming CPE is committed to informing members
and guests about Tucson's Desert Angels and their focus on
funding entrepreneurial ventures. You will have an
opportunity to meet and interact with the speaker - Robert
Morrison, Executive Director of Tucson's Desert Angels.
Mr. Morrison has been involved in all phases of
technology business development. He is a founder of Sunquest
Information Systems, which became the world's largest vendor of
hospital laboratory information automation products. Robert
Morrison is also a Mentor in Residence at the University of
Arizona's Eller College of Management's McGuire Center for Entrepreneurship.

$$$ SCHOLARSHIPS AVAILABLE $$$
|
Please be thinking of friends and acquaintances who would
be interested in a helping hand with their school expenses.
Our past recipients have been very grateful for this assistance.
Four $750 scholarships will be awarded in December for female
accounting majors who have taken a non-traditional path to their
education. The money will be available in time for use
during the Spring 2011 semester. We also consider GPA
and financial need when making our decision of who will
receive the scholarships.
We will accept applications beginning September 15. You may
contact Deb Hutchinson at 352-1212 to obtain a form or e-mail her
at Deborah.Hutchinson@cliftoncpa.com to obtain an
application. The cut-off for accepting applications is
November 15.

In an effort to give back to the community, the AWSCPA
Tucson affiliate has started a tradition of collecting donations
for select charities and other charitable endeavors each year. We
also have our own scholarship fund through which we have given
scholarships to deserving college students - we awarded four
$750 scholarships last year and three $750 scholarships the
year before. We have also collected clothing for the YWCA
Your Sister's Closet. This year we have plans to help the community
as follows:
YWCA Your Sister's Closet This worthy organization
provides unemployed women with clothing that is appropriate for job
interviews and to begin employment. They need professional clothing
that is stylish, clean and preferably ON HANGERS. Clean out a
closet and bring your gently used items to our next luncheon.
You'll receive a receipt for your contribution, and we'll take care
of delivering them to the YWCA. Find out more about this
organization by visiting their website at www.ywcatucson.org/.
SCHOLARSHIPS The Tucson AWSCPA has a scholarship
program for female accounting students who have taken a
non-traditional path to their education. We plan
to award four scholarships of $750 each this year.
